Understanding Speed Units
Speed is the rate at which an object covers distance. Different fields and regions use different units to measure it.
Common Units
- MPH (Miles per Hour): Used in the US and UK for road traffic.
- KPH (Kilometers per Hour): The standard for road traffic in most other countries.
- Knots: Used in aviation and maritime contexts. 1 Knot = 1 Nautical Mile per hour.
- m/s (Meters per Second): The SI unit for speed, used in physics and engineering.
- Mach: Used for high-speed aircraft. Mach 1 is the speed of sound (~767 mph at sea level).

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
What is MPH?
MPH stands for Miles Per Hour. It is the standard unit of speed in the United States and United Kingdom.
What is KPH?
KPH (or km/h) stands for Kilometers Per Hour. It is the standard unit of speed in most of the world.
What is a Knot?
A Knot is one nautical mile per hour. It is used primarily in aviation and maritime navigation.
What is Mach?
Mach number is the ratio of flow velocity past a boundary to the local speed of sound. Mach 1 is the speed of sound.
